Transaction 04329ae02fc824b56b1f9f31e23a73c9e44e8f52d680247b9031731d4621251c

1 Input
1 Outputs
  • 04329ae02fc824b56b1f9f31e23a73c9e44e8f52d680247b9031731d4621251c:0
  • value  1356472266
    address  1CK6KHY6MHgYvmRQ4PAafKYDrg1ejbH1cE